Product Description:
The MS2N05-B0BNN-CMDG1-NNANN-NN Servo Motor is produced by Bosch Rexroth Indramat. This servo motor is suitable for controlling motion in industrial automation systems. When the temperature is 100K, it can reach a rated speed of 2850 1/min. The torque capacity of this motor at 100K is 3.72 Nm.
The maximum amount of current the MS2N05-B0BNN-CMDG1-NNANN-NN servo motor can consume is 2.36 A. The motor can produce 1.11 kW of power at 100 K. It produces 2.29 A with no movement at 60 K. The value for 100K standstill is 2.75 amps. When the MS2N05-B0BNN-CMDG1-NNANN-NN servo motor is cold, its maximum torque is 11.5 Nm. When the coil is fully heated, it reaches a maximum torque of 10.6 Nm. According to its rating, this model can deliver a maximum of 8.4 A rms. Electrical maximum speed is also possible at a rate of 6000 revolutions per minute. The motor’s rotor has a moment of inertia of 0.00028 kg·m². It is stated that the torque constant is equal to 1.78 Nm for every ampere at 20°C. There are five pole pairs inside the motor. Because of these specifications, servo motors can move with great accuracy.
The MS2N05-B0BNN-CMDG1-NNANN-NN servo motor features a built-in holding brake. There is a holding torque of 10.00 Nm provided by the brake. It works on the brake system’s 24 V voltage rating.
